    private XmlQueryExpression getQuery(Map<String, Set<AttributeBean>> attributeMap,
                                        XmlQueryContext context,
                                        int r) throws XmlException  {
        // The dimensions for this query.
        StringBuilder sb = new StringBuilder();
        for (Set<AttributeBean> attributeBeans : attributeMap.values()) {
            sb.append(attributeBeans.size() + ":");
            for (AttributeBean bean : attributeBeans) {
                sb.append(bean.getValues().size() + "-");
            }
        }

        // If a query of these dimensions already exists, then just return it.
        String hash = sb.toString() + r;
        XmlQueryExpression result = m_queries.get(hash);
        if (result != null) {
            return result;
        }

        // We do not have a query of those dimensions. We must make one.
        String query = createQuery(attributeMap);

        if (log.isDebugEnabled()) {
            log.debug("Query [" + hash + "]:\n" + query);
        }

        // Once we have created a query, we can parse it and store the
        // execution plan. This is an expensive operation that we do
        // not want to have to do more than once for each dimension
        result = m_dbXmlManager.manager.prepare(query, context);

        m_queries.put(hash, result);

        return result;
    }

    public boolean updatePolicy(String name, String newDocument)
            throws PolicyIndexException {
        log.debug("Updating document: " + name);

        // FIXME:  DBXML container.updateDocument is failing to update document metadata (this tested on DBXML ver 2.5.13)
        // specifically anySubject, anyResource metadata elements are not changing
        // if Subjects and Resources elements are added/deleted from document.


        // FIXME: this will acquire and release write locks for each operation
        // should instead do this just once for an update
        deletePolicy(name);
        addPolicy(name, newDocument);

        // FIXME:  code below would also need updating for transactions, deadlocks, single thread updates...

        /* original code below works apart from metadata update not happening
        try {
            utils.validate(newDocument, name);
        } catch (MelcoePDPException e) {
            throw new PolicyIndexException(e);
        }

        XmlTransaction txn = null;

        try {
            try {
                txn = dbXmlManager.manager.createTransaction();
                XmlDocument doc = makeDocument(name, newDocument);
                dbXmlManager.container.updateDocument(txn, doc, dbXmlManager.updateContext);
                txn.commit();
                setLastUpdate(System.currentTimeMillis());
            } catch (XmlException xe) {
                txn.abort();
                throw new PolicyIndexException("Error updating document: "
                                                             + name,
                                                     xe);
            }
        } catch (XmlException xe) {
            throw new PolicyIndexException("Error aborting transaction: "
                    + xe.getMessage(), xe);
        }
        */

        return true;
    }
